Title: NINJA AI Accessibility
Author: Sebastjan
Published: <strong>2026년 5월 25일</strong>
Last modified: 2026년 5월 25일

---

플러그인 검색

![](https://ps.w.org/ninja-ai-accessibility/assets/banner-772x250.png?rev=3549008)

![](https://ps.w.org/ninja-ai-accessibility/assets/icon.svg?rev=3549008)

# NINJA AI Accessibility

 작성자: [Sebastjan](https://profiles.wordpress.org/sstucl/)

[다운로드](https://downloads.wordpress.org/plugin/ninja-ai-accessibility.1.0.0.zip)

 * [세부사항](https://ko.wordpress.org/plugins/ninja-ai-accessibility/#description)
 * [평가](https://ko.wordpress.org/plugins/ninja-ai-accessibility/#reviews)
 *  [설치](https://ko.wordpress.org/plugins/ninja-ai-accessibility/#installation)
 * [개발](https://ko.wordpress.org/plugins/ninja-ai-accessibility/#developers)

 [지원](https://wordpress.org/support/plugin/ninja-ai-accessibility/)

## 설명

The European Accessibility Act (in force since June 2025) and WCAG 2.1 AA make
 
accessibility a legal requirement, not a nice-to-have. NINJA AI Accessibility scans
every published post and page for the barriers you can actually fix and scores each
one 0–100, worst-first.

**This is not an accessibility “overlay.”** Overlay widgets don’t create
 compliance—
courts have repeatedly ruled against them, and in 2025 a large share of accessibility
lawsuits targeted sites that had one installed. We don’t hide problems behind a 
toolbar; we find the real ones in your content and tell you how to fix them.

**What it checks (per post/page, scored 0–100):**

 * **Image alt text** (WCAG 1.1.1) — flags images with no `alt` attribute. Valid
   
   decorative images (`alt=""`) are correctly left alone, so you don’t get false
   positives.
 * **Link purpose** (WCAG 2.4.4) — empty links and vague text like “click here”
   
   or “read more” that tell a screen-reader user nothing out of context.
 * **Heading structure** (WCAG 1.3.1) — skipped heading levels and multiple H1s
   
   that break the document outline.
 * **Frame titles** (WCAG 4.1.2) — embedded iframes (video, maps) with no title.
 * **Table headers** (WCAG 1.3.1) — data tables missing `<th>` header cells.

**EAA readiness panel:** checks for a published accessibility statement and a
 declared
document language.

**Honest about its limits.** Some criteria — colour contrast, keyboard focus
 order,
theme landmarks — depend on rendered styles and can’t be judged from content alone,
so we never claim to. Use this to fix what’s findable and pair it with a manual 
review for full WCAG 2.1 AA / EAA conformance. The free plugin runs entirely on 
your site and makes **no external requests**.

### NINJA AI Accessibility Pro (optional add-on)

NINJA AI Accessibility Pro (from https://ninja.si — not the WordPress.org
 directory)
adds one-click, AI-assisted remediation (e.g. generating descriptive alt text from
each image) and **Accessibility Watch** — it re-scans on a schedule and emails you
when a new publish introduces a barrier or your score drops. Pro is the only part
that contacts ninja.si, and only after you register.

## 스크린샷

[⌊Overview — your accessibility score, EAA readiness (accessibility statement + 
document language) and a plain "why this matters" with an honest disclaimer.⌉⌊Overview—
your accessibility score, EAA readiness (accessibility statement + document language)
and a plain "why this matters" with an honest disclaimer.⌉[

Overview — your accessibility score, EAA readiness (accessibility statement + document
language) and a plain “why this matters” with an honest disclaimer.

[⌊Overview — per-check WCAG coverage (alt text, link purpose, heading structure,
frame titles, table headers) and your worst-scoring pages.⌉⌊Overview — per-check
WCAG coverage (alt text, link purpose, heading structure, frame titles, table headers)
and your worst-scoring pages.⌉[

Overview — per-check WCAG coverage (alt text, link purpose, heading structure, frame
titles, table headers) and your worst-scoring pages.

[⌊Audit — every published post and page scored 0–100, with WCAG-tagged issues and
a link straight to the editor.⌉⌊Audit — every published post and page scored 0–100,
with WCAG-tagged issues and a link straight to the editor.⌉[

Audit — every published post and page scored 0–100, with WCAG-tagged issues and 
a link straight to the editor.

## 설치

 1. In your WordPress admin go to **Plugins  Add New**, search for “NINJA AI Accessibility”
    and click **Install Now** — or upload the ZIP under **Plugins  Add New  Upload 
    Plugin**.
 2. Click **Activate**.
 3. Open **Accessibility** in the admin menu. The Overview tab shows your site score
    and EAA readiness; the Audit tab scores every post and page with a prioritized 
    issue list and links straight to the editor.

No account, API key or external service is required.

## FAQ

### Is this an accessibility overlay?

No — and that’s the point. Overlays don’t make a site compliant and have lost in

court. This plugin audits your real content so you can fix the underlying issues.

### Does it make my site WCAG/EAA compliant on its own?

No plugin can. It finds and helps you fix the content-level barriers it can
 reliably
detect; full conformance also needs a manual review (contrast, keyboard use, focus
order). We’re explicit about what we can and can’t check.

### Does the free plugin send data anywhere?

No. All scanning happens locally in your WordPress install.

## 후기

이 플러그인에 대한 평가가 없습니다.

## 기여자 & 개발자

“NINJA AI Accessibility”(은)는 오픈 소스 소프트웨어입니다. 다음의 사람들이 이 플러그인에
기여하였습니다.

기여자

 *   [ Sebastjan ](https://profiles.wordpress.org/sstucl/)

[자국어로 “NINJA AI Accessibility”(을)를 번역하세요.](https://translate.wordpress.org/projects/wp-plugins/ninja-ai-accessibility)

### 개발에 관심이 있으십니까?

[코드 탐색하기](https://plugins.trac.wordpress.org/browser/ninja-ai-accessibility/)
는, [SVN 저장소](https://plugins.svn.wordpress.org/ninja-ai-accessibility/)를 확인하시거나,
[개발 기록](https://plugins.trac.wordpress.org/log/ninja-ai-accessibility/)을 [RSS](https://plugins.trac.wordpress.org/log/ninja-ai-accessibility/?limit=100&mode=stop_on_copy&format=rss)
로 구독하세요.

## 변경이력

#### 1.0.0

 * Initial release: WCAG 2.1 content audit (alt text, link purpose, heading
    structure,
   frame titles, table headers), 0–100 scoring, EAA readiness panel, and a prioritized
   per-page audit.

## 기초

 *  버전 **1.0.0**
 *  최근 업데이트: **1개월 전**
 *  활성화된 설치 **10보다 적음**
 *  워드프레스 버전 ** 6.8 또는 그 이상 **
 *  다음까지 시험됨: **7.0**
 *  PHP 버전 ** 7.4 또는 그 이상 **
 *  언어
 * [English (US)](https://wordpress.org/plugins/ninja-ai-accessibility/)
 * 태그:
 * [accessibility](https://ko.wordpress.org/plugins/tags/accessibility/)[ada](https://ko.wordpress.org/plugins/tags/ada/)
   [Alt Text](https://ko.wordpress.org/plugins/tags/alt-text/)[EAA](https://ko.wordpress.org/plugins/tags/eaa/)
   [wcag](https://ko.wordpress.org/plugins/tags/wcag/)
 *  [고급 보기](https://ko.wordpress.org/plugins/ninja-ai-accessibility/advanced/)

## 평점

아직 제출된 리뷰가 없습니다.

[Your review](https://wordpress.org/support/plugin/ninja-ai-accessibility/reviews/#new-post)

[모든  리뷰 보기](https://wordpress.org/support/plugin/ninja-ai-accessibility/reviews/)

## 기여자

 *   [ Sebastjan ](https://profiles.wordpress.org/sstucl/)

## 지원

할 말 있으신가요? 도움이 필요하신가요?

 [지원 포럼 보기](https://wordpress.org/support/plugin/ninja-ai-accessibility/)